Abstract

Provided are methods for determining or predicting the diagnosis, prognosis, treatment and therapeutic efficacy of melanoma in a subject, which include evaluating the expression level of one or more miRNA biomarkers including miRNA-4487, miRNA-4706, miRNA-4731 and fragments or variants thereof as an indication of whether the subject may have, or be predisposed to, melanoma.

Claims

exact text as granted — not AI-modified
1 . A method of determining whether or not a subject has melanoma, including:
 determining an expression level of one or more miRNA biomarkers in a biological sample from a subject, wherein the one or more miRNA biomarkers are selected from the group consisting of miRNA-4487, miRNA-4706 and miRNA-4731, or a fragment or variant thereof, and wherein melanoma is detected if said expression level of one or more miRNA biomarkers is altered or modulated in the biological sample.   
     
     
         2 . A method of determining the prognosis of a subject with melanoma, including:
 determining an expression level of one or more miRNA biomarkers in a biological sample obtained from the subject, wherein the one or more miRNA biomarkers are selected from the group consisting of miRNA-4487, miRNA-4706 and miRNA-4731, or a fragment or variant thereof, to thereby evaluate the prognosis of melanoma in the subject.   
     
     
         3 . The method of  claim 2 , wherein if the expression level of said one or more miRNA biomarkers is altered or modulated in the biological sample, the prognosis may be negative or positive. 
     
     
         4 . The method of  claim 3 , wherein the prognosis is used, at least in part, to determine whether the subject would benefit from treatment of melanoma. 
     
     
         5 . The method of  claim 3 , wherein the prognosis is used, at least in part, to develop a treatment strategy for the subject. 
     
     
         6 . The method of  claim 2 , wherein the prognosis is used, at least in part, to determine disease progression in the subject. 
     
     
         7 . The method of  claim 2 , wherein prognosis is defined as an estimated time of survival. 
     
     
         8 . The method of  claim 2 , further including determining suitability of the subject for treatment based, at least in part, on the prognosis. 
     
     
         9 . The method of  claim 1 , further including determining a disease stage and/or grade for melanoma based on, at least in part, the expression level of the one or more miRNA biomarkers. 
     
     
         10 . The method of  claim 1 , wherein the expression level of the one or more miRNA biomarkers is determined before, during and/or after treatment. 
     
     
         11 . A method of treating melanoma in a subject including;
 determining an expression level of one or more miRNA biomarkers in a biological sample from the subject, before, during and/or after treatment of melanoma, wherein the one or more miRNA biomarkers are selected from the group consisting of miRNA-4487, miRNA-4706 and miRNA-4731, or a fragment or variant thereof, and based on the determination made, initiating, continuing, modifying or discontinuing a treatment of melanoma.   
     
     
         12 . A method of evaluating treatment efficacy of melanoma in a subject including:
 determining an expression level of one or more miRNA biomarkers in a biological sample from the subject before, during and/or after treatment, wherein the one or more miRNA biomarkers are selected from the group consisting of miRNA-4487, miRNA-4706 and miRNA-4731, or a fragment or variant thereof; and   determining whether or not the treatment is efficacious according to whether said expression level of one or more miRNA biomarkers is altered or modulated in the subject's biological sample.   
     
     
         13 . The method of  claim 11 , further including selecting a treatment for melanoma based on the expression level of the one or more miRNA biomarkers. 
     
     
         14 . The method of  claim 11 , further including measuring an expression level of one or more additional miRNA biomarkers selected from the group consisting of miRNA-16, miRNA-211, miRNA-509-3p and miRNA-509-5p, or a fragment or variant thereof. 
     
     
         15 - 20 . (canceled) 
     
     
         21 . The method of  claim 1 , further including measuring an expression level of one or more additional miRNA biomarkers selected from the group consisting of miRNA-16, miRNA-211, miRNA-509-3p and miRNA-509-5p, or a fragment or variant thereof. 
     
     
         22 . The method of  claim 2 , further including determining a disease stage and/or grade for melanoma based on, at least in part, the expression level of the one or more miRNA biomarkers. 
     
     
         23 . The method of  claim 2 , wherein the expression level of the one or more miRNA biomarkers is determined before, during and/or after treatment. 
     
     
         24 . The method of  claim 2 , further including measuring an expression level of one or more additional miRNA biomarkers selected from the group consisting of miRNA-16, miRNA-211, miRNA-509-3p and miRNA-509-5p, or a fragment or variant thereof. 
     
     
         25 . The method of  claim 12 , further including selecting a treatment for melanoma based on the expression level of the one or more miRNA biomarkers. 
     
     
         26 . The method of  claim 12 , further including measuring an expression level of one or more additional miRNA biomarkers selected from the group consisting of miRNA-16, miRNA-211, miRNA-509-3p and miRNA-509-5p, or a fragment or variant thereof.
